I got a new voltage regulator from E-bay (actually a '53 model) and a horn relay from a friend. I tried to keep the same wire routing scheme as the original. But I just couldn't resist using the plastic coil wrap instead of tape. The main firewall grommet, I got from Restoration World. The others I made by gluing pieces of rubber weather stripping together (with super glue) and cutting out the exact shape on a band saw. The firewall really needs to be airtight.
